On August the 11th 1960 a dark blue, all-aluminium Ferrari 250 GT short wheelbase Berlinetta Competizione left Maranello on its way to Rob Walker, whose team would go on to run the car at Goodwood in the RAC Tourist Trophy race later that month. This legendary 250 GT Short Wheelbase (known by its chassis number of 2119 GT) is the very same car Sir Stirling Moss won in three times, and Mike Parkes another three.

After the 1961 season, 2119GT disappeared into private ownership for over three decades, and was next seen in public at Goodwood at the inaugural Festival of Speed in 1993 where it has become a frequent visitor. It is now owned by motorsport maestro Ross Brawn and is often shown at festivals such as Goodwood Revival.
